Visualizzazione dei risultati da 1 a 7 su 7

Discussione: chiudere div

  1. #1
    Utente di HTML.it L'avatar di agenti
    Registrato dal
    Feb 2002
    Messaggi
    2,427

    chiudere div

    ho utilizzato un div per creare un semplice messaggio di errore:

    <div style="position: absolute; visibility:hidden; width: 100px; height: 100px; z-index: 1; background-color: #FF0000" id="livello1">
    <font color="#FFFFFF" size="1" face="Verdana"> <%=rs("operatore")%> può
    modificare la pagina</font>
    </div>

    vorrei chiaramente chiuderlo/nasconderlo su un clic utente

    come fare?

  2. #2
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    onclick="document.getElementById('livello1').style .visibility='hidden';"

    oppure:
    onclick="document.getElementById('livello1').style .display='none';"

    Il primo lo rende invisibile, il secondo lo elimina dalla pagina (lo spazio viene recuperato)
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  3. #3
    Frontend samurai L'avatar di fcaldera
    Registrato dal
    Feb 2003
    Messaggi
    12,924
    oppure this.style.display o this.style.visibility
    se sono sull'evento onclick
    Vuoi aiutare la riforestazione responsabile?

    Iscriviti a Ecologi e inizia a rimuovere la tua impronta ecologica (30 alberi extra usando il referral)

  4. #4
    Utente di HTML.it L'avatar di agenti
    Registrato dal
    Feb 2002
    Messaggi
    2,427
    scusate ma io sono un pò crucco in javascript...


    dovrei usare questonclick="document.getElementById('livello1').style. visibility='hidden';"



    mettiamo che l'evento onclick lo genera un normale link:

    <href"javascriptnclick="document.getElementById 'livello1').style.visibility='hidden';" chiudi alert</a>


    sbaglio qualcosa??

  5. #5
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    Forse sei "crucco" in HTML:

    chiudi alert
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  6. #6
    Utente di HTML.it L'avatar di agenti
    Registrato dal
    Feb 2002
    Messaggi
    2,427
    credo di si...
    meno male che ho voi

  7. #7
    Utente di HTML.it L'avatar di agenti
    Registrato dal
    Feb 2002
    Messaggi
    2,427
    qualcosa non va appare ma non si chiude:

    <div style='border:2px groove #C0C0C0; position: absolute; width: 183px; height: 101px; z-index: 1; left: 429px; top: 238px; background-color: #FF0000' id='messaggio'>
    <p align='center'><font face='Verdana' size='2' color='#FFFFFF'>Messaggio

    nbsp;
    </font><p align='center'>
    <font face='Verdana' size='2' color='#FFFFFF'>ATTENZIONE

    </font><font face='Verdana' size='2' color='#FFFFFF'>Solo l'operatore "&operatore&"
    può modificare la pratica o inviare messaggi

    </font><font face='Verdana' size='1' color='#FFFFFF'><a href='#' onclick='document.getElementById('messaggio').styl e.visibility='hidden'; return false;'>
    <font color='#FFFFFF'>chiudi alert</font></a>
    </font>
    </div>

    in basso del browser visalizzo: errore di caricamento pagina.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.